Estonian DeepTech startup Jälle Applied sciences raises €2 million to fight the “tidal wave of lifeless batteries”

Tallinn-based Jälle Applied sciences has secured a €2 million pre-Seed spherical to advance its mission of recovering worth from end-of-life lithium-ion batteries and changing usually discarded graphite waste into high-value, next-generation carbon-based supplies.

The spherical combines aggressive grant assist from Enterprise Estonia (EIS) and the Environmental Funding Centre (KIK) with early-stage fairness funding from Nordic and Baltic impact-driven VC companies together with Kiilto Ventures, 2C Ventures, in addition to participation from angel buyers Andrus Purde and Priit Viru.

Based in 2023, Jälle Applied sciences is a DeepTech firm on a mission to get better crucial uncooked supplies from end-of-life batteries. By delivering environment friendly and sustainable recycling options for Li-ion batteries, Jälle goals to assist Europe’s transition to a low-carbon, resource-secure, and really round financial system.

Jälle provides a science-driven resolution to this problem. Based by scientists decided to resolve the battery business’s waste downside at scale, together with Kerli Liivand, Martin Jantson, Reio Praats, Erki Ani, and Ivar Kruusenberg, the corporate grew out of superior supplies analysis at Estonia’s Nationwide Institute of Chemical Physics and Biophysics.

With Europe aiming for 70% recycling effectivity for lithium-ion batteries, and end-of-life battery volumes projected to surpass 230 kilotonnes by 2030, a 70-fold enhance over 2020, as we speak’s recycling applied sciences want main developments to satisfy provide chain calls for.

Past tackling the battery recycling effectivity problem and reaching excessive restoration charges for lithium, the corporate’s core lies in upcycling usually discarded waste graphite into high-value graphene-like supplies.

Few-layer graphene-based supplies – amidst 2D supplies – are among the many world’s thinnest identified supplies, celebrated for his or her excessive energy, conductivity, and suppleness, making these upcycled supplies precious for superior purposes.

The brand new funding shall be used to broaden pilot-scale manufacturing, validate Jälle’s proprietary processes at scale, and develop the corporate’s group in Estonia with hiring already ongoing.
